    Kendrick Nunn – Personal and Professional Details

    Full NameKendrick Melvin Nunn
    Date of BirthAugust 3, 1995
    Age30 years
    BirthplaceChicago, Illinois, United States
    Height1.95 m (6 ft 5 in)
    Weight88 kg (194 lbs)
    PositionShooting Guard
    TeamPanathinaikos
    LeaguesGreek Basketball League, EuroLeague
    NationalityAmerican
    CollegeUniversity of Illinois, Oakland University
    Notable AwardsEuroLeague MVP (2025), Alphonso Ford Top Scorer Trophy, NBA All-Rookie First Team (2020)
    Contract€13.5 million for 3 years (2025–2028)

    He had a particularly outstanding 2024–2025 EuroLeague season. He contributed rebounds, assists, a game-winning block, and 26 points, including 13 in the last quarter, in Game 5 of the playoffs against Maccabi Tel Aviv. Of all the players that evening, he had the highest Performance Index Rating (27). His stamina—the capacity to maintain intensity late into the game, which is a direct result of his rigorous fitness and weight discipline—was what made this accomplishment more remarkable.

    Nunn had already shown impressive discipline in his weight management while he was with the Miami Heat. He was slim yet strong going into each season, which made him both explosive and elusive. He was selected to the NBA All-Rookie First Team due to his impressive concentration on physical consistency and skill, as well as his rookie season average of 15.3 points per game and effective shooting.

    He needed to be further refined after moving to Europe. A distinct type of endurance was required by the EuroLeague’s tactical framework and more demanding scheduling. Trainers placed a strong emphasis on lower-body power, muscle suppleness, and core stability—all of which are essential for verticality and defense. After months of adjustment, Nunn developed a type of balance that gave him a distinct advantage on both ends of the floor. He was stable in collisions because of his weight, but he was still quick enough to penetrate defenses with amazing accuracy.

    By December 2024, he was at his best. Nunn scored 21 points and made seven three-pointers in the first quarter, setting two EuroLeague records in one game. Kendrick Nunn, who averaged a season-high three-point shooting percentage, became the first Panathinaikos player to win the Alphonso Ford EuroLeague Top Scorer Trophy in 2025. In Europe, his reliability established new benchmarks for performance. He became the highest-paid player in EuroLeague history in April 2025 when Panathinaikos rewarded his brilliance with a three-year contract worth €13.5 million.

    It was a symbolic economic milestone as well. It represented the realization that greatness transcends innate ability and the increasing importance of self-control and flexibility in contemporary basketball. Even though Vasilije Micić’s €14 million contract eventually outbid Nunn’s, Nunn’s contract was a game-changer for American athletes hoping to succeed overseas.
